Day 51:
We pass from Finland to Germany to support German Muslim - League Bonn CC (Deutsche Muslim-Liga Bonn E.V.). The purpose of this very active group is: “to promote a dialogue between all human beings with particular emphasis on members of the Abrahamic religions.”
We read about them in our community directory: “We are an association of Muslims and friends of Islam, of men and women, whose aim and praxis is to function as bridge between Muslims and people of other faiths or none, to work for understanding among religions, and to conduct dialogue among different sectors of civil society and public life. Whereas these efforts encompass dialogue with all human beings, particular emphasis is given to those belonging to the Abrahamic religions. Approximately twelve interfaith conferences every year are being co-organised by us. Since 1987, we have been the Islamic Sponsoring Organisation of the 'Standing Conference of Jews, Christians and Muslims in Europe' (JCM), assembling twice a year at the Hedwig-Dransfeld-Haus, Bendorf. Additionally we offer a wide range of lectures, one-day conferences, regular interfaith prayer meetings, travels and planning meetings, on a nearly daily basis. We began in 1983 as the Bonn branch of the German Muslim-League, Hamburg, Germany, which is the oldest uninterruptedly existing Islamic association in Germany, having been founded in 1952 in Hamburg and officially registered in 1954.”

Day 45:
The CC we are supporting today is Balkan as a Soul-Bridge CC. It is quite clear how important the purposes of Soul-Bridge CC are in Bosnia and Herzagovina: “developing relationships with and appreciation of different cultures and religions" and "joint action; building a network for peace; launching URI in Mostar, Bosnia." They describe their work like this: "Our aim is to organize a conference in Bosnia and Herzegovina, 'Millenium Rainbow of Mostar' (English)/‘Mostarska Duga Novog Milenija’ (Bosnian). This event will bring young people together in Mostar, half of them from Bosnia and Herzegovina (of Bosniak, Croatian and Serbian background), the other half from various European countries. The conference program is planned to be comprised of different elements, e.g. workshops on communication skills; lectures and discussion-groups; a pilgrimage to important places of different traditions in the Mostar-region (Catholic, Muslim, Serbian-Orthodox, Jewish); an art-exhibition, fashion-show and a concert; prayers for peace of all religions involved; trip to seaside; workshop on environmental challenges; ceremony on Mostar-bridge with an inter-religious choir; introduction to URI; and developing action-plan for further activities. After an excellent start we are currently facing the challenges of fund-raising and finding volunteers and time to continue our work.” As we read this and imagine the challenge, we make their purpose ours as we pray/meditate.
